Here is a 7 inch black scaled genuine Italian stiletto with a bayonet blade. Tang stamped Rosfrei.
No play when opened and just about jumps out of your hand when the button is pushed. Safety works good.
UNFORTUNATELY I noticed when taking the pictures it has a defect in the brass liner. It has a slight crease in the liner next to the back spring on the button side. Even with the front pin. Maybe they did it when they pinned the scale. It doesn't effect the function of the knife at all. (see 4th picture)
